Job Title: Controller

Classification: Full-Time, Exempt

Department: Finance & Administration

Reports to: Chief Financial Officer

Location: Meridian, ID

Apply: https://idahofoodbank.org/about/employment/

COMPLETED APPLICATIONS ARE REQUIRED TO BE CONSIDERED FOR THIS POSITION.

Job Summary:

Play a key role in overseeing the financial health of our organization, ensuring accuracy in financial reporting, and providing strategic financial guidance to senior management. The successful candidate will have a strong background in managing and developing people, financial analysis, budgeting, and internal controls.

Principle Duties and Responsibilities:

Lead and inspire a team of two Accounting and one IT Staff and encourage their growth and development.

Ensure accurate and timely reconciliation of bank accounts and general and subsidiary ledgers.

Provide monthly financial reports and dashboard with variance explanations.

Coordinate monthly close process.

Ad hoc data analysis and reporting as required.

Analyze and monitor cash management.

Assist with annual budget and monthly forecast development.

Administer grant tracking including government programs and reporting.

Assist with audit preparation and audited financial statements. Resolve accounting discrepancies and irregularities. Create schedules and financial statement notes.

Prepare general journal entries, and accruals.

Maintain and enforce Internal Controls throughout the organization.

Maintain Standard Operating Procedures (SOP’s) for all processes.

Maintain fixed assets, roll forward schedules, and reconciliation to general ledger. Book monthly and year end reconciled depreciation.

Operate computer programs, accounting software, and general office equipment.

Preparation of the annual IRS 990 tax form.

Backup for Payroll and AP processing.

Perform other related duties as requested.
